mackinac bridge walk

For my fourth (4th) year in a row I did the Mackinac Bridge Walk in Mackinac, MI. Curt and his brother have done the walk for as long as he can remember, and the year we met, he invited me with him.I've been going back ever since. The bridge itself is five (5) miles long, but the walk total is about 7 miles after you add the distance to the bridge and off of the bridge.
Mackinac Bridge Walk Photo thanks to mackinacbridge.org

This year was my best ever beating all the others in my group (Curt, his brother Matt and Matt's girlfriend Robyn) time wise. So what if Curt didn't feel well, Robyn gets motion sickness so she took Dramamine (which had the wonderful side-effect of making her drowsy) and Matt's calves gave out on him early on . . . I still did good! =]

If you've never taken part in this wonderful Michigan tradition, I truly suggest you do so. I personally think it is a definite must-experience for a Michigander.
